Very old inside, very nice outside...
Theory the hotel is five stars, well... It's very old, like 25-30 years old, and you can feel it from almost verythingh in the rooms: towels, sun chairs, furnitures, floorboard, shower are just some examples which make you understand how is old. Helpful and friendly reception; the best part is certainly the pools area, with 3 pools with bar, a lot of gardens with palms and direct access to the beach; litlle but nice and efficient Spa with good staff. Foods, poor quality breakfast and dinner. The big mistake of the management i think was mix the all-inclusive guests with normal guests who pay extra for dinner, they eat all together in the same buffet restaurant, but as everybody who already traveled a little bit knows, the quality of foods and drinks in the all-inclusive restaurants is quite poor. There's an other luxury A la carte restaurant in the hotel, like the hotel broucher and Melia site said, which could be a nice solution, but of course it's closed, also in high season.

Would not return
What a shame this hotel is so remote. There was absolutely nowhere to walk outside the hotel other than on the beach. Decent enough service and superb food in main restaurant. The room was shabby and unimpressive and the balcony small by 5 star standards. Shame because we had a lovely sea view. The swimming area and main pool was excellent but it proved a struggle at Easter to find a sunbed after 11am. Nice Internet cabin by the pool with books to borrow and read. Small spa looked good but needed more facilities to really impress. Poolside restaurant was very uninspiring. Lack of any organised activities aside from the water aerobics and a decent kiddie club. Breakfast on the verandah was ruined by the sheeting draped over the sides of the verandah which ruined the effect completely. Some building work evident but then this ageing hotel is rather in need of a face lift. Very mature and pleasant grounds. Direct access to the beach. Piano and Harpist with dinner. Location was a major drawback for me. Not going back.

An excellent holiday hotel for the mature person
This traditional hotel, built about 30 years ago, caters mainly for the more mature holidaymaker and has many guests who return year after year. Rooms (non smoking) are large, well equipped and comfortable and all have full bathrooms en suite. The main restaurant is mainly self service with numerous chefs preparing dishes to individual order, in addition to the impressive range of pre-prepared and attractively set out dishes. Quality is high and waiters (who bring drinks and clear away) are friendly and efficient, most having been there since the hotel opened! A harpist plays at breakfast and a pianist at dinner. The grounds are spacious and quite beautiful at all times of year and there is no shortage of sunbeds. The hotel boasts a Casino on the lower ground floor. This is not a hotel for those seeking bright lights and loud music but is one which offers comfort and tranquility.
